Governor of Benue State, Hyacinth Alia, has credited President Bola Tinubu for his administration’s accomplishments in its first year in office.
According to NEWS 360 INFO, this information was revealed on Friday by the politician-turned-cleric while on a thank-you trip in the Makurdi/Guma Federal Constituency.
Alia claimed that Tinubu was responsible for all of the accomplishments listed in the state’s records, including the building of roads, an underpass, the payment of salaries, pensions, and gratuities, as well as the remodeling of the Assembly Complex and State Secretariat.
